Toronto Seminar & New Jersey Workshop

Just returned from a whirlwind tour of Toronto and New Jersey.

In Toronto I gave a seminar on behalf of WEVA International at the PMA Expo. It was entitled “Wedding Videography: Creativity That Sells”. Had a great time, and the Canadians were extremely hospitable. Toronto’s premier videographer, David Lai from Visions By David, and his lovely wife Marianne showed me around the beautiful city.

_12t1967-large.jpg

On to New Jersey, where the NYPVA hosted my all-day workshop. Kathy and Al Ritondo went above and beyond the call of duty and ensured a full house with standing room only. The East Coast attendees were wonderful, and we had a phenomenal day of sharing and learning.

Bryan’s Bar Mitzvah

September 15th, 2007

Bryan read from the Torah at the Wilshire Boulevard Temple. In the evening the party celebrations took off at Hillcrest Country Club. The theme was Roller coasters, and we put together a concept video for Bryan, featuring Fred Willard and his genius brand of comedy.
The event was planned by good friend Debbie Powell of Hold The Date. Photographs were taken by Cindy Gold and Claudia Wong. Entertainment was provided by Percy from Feet First Entertainment.

Mazel Tov to Bryan and his entire family.
